| I downloaded 3DMark06 and tried it out tonight, and I gotta say I got some very different results than when I run 3DM05. I still only got the "short" version, even though the whole thing is over 500MB. I will usually get a 3DMark score of 7600 or so in 3DM05 (on my OC), but with this new one I get about half the score I was expecting. And in the 05 version, my frame rates show in the high 20s, 30s and 40s - where this one shows much lower fps for some reason. These were my results: 3838 3DMarks SM2.0 Score: 1663 HDR/SM3.0: 1656 CPU Score: 1077 Return to Proxycon: 13.080fps Firefly Forest: 14.641fps Canyon Flight: 14.193fps Deep Freeze: 18.929fps CPU1: Red Valley 0.338fps CPU2: Red Vallet 0.548fps I don't know...maybe this one would get better results on a 7900 or 7950, but I don't consider my 7800 a slouch. | Gig-O-Ram: You have a single core processor. 3DMark06 shows MUCH higher scores on dual core CPUs. Further, 3DMark scores aren't everything, can you play your games the way you want to play them? If the answer to that question is "yes," then who cares what your 3DMark score is? I use it for bragging rights, that's it. I can beat out 9k in '06 at least, and over 12k in '05. But it really doesn't matter as much as people think it does. While 3DMark is relevant, it is not the be-all-end-all benchmark. |
